Disney World decided to open up its parks while coronavirus cases continue to rise in the country, especially in Florida. But if you do go, it won’t be like a normal Disney trip. All guests have to reserve tickets ahead of time before going to the parks. Guests are required to get a temperature check before entering and have to wear a mask at all times. Workers are wiping down and cleaning rides often, and there are markings on the ground to make sure that people keep a safe distance away from each other. Even characters are keeping their distance.

There are no meet and greets and characters are keeping their distance from guests by waving from rooftops and balconies. Even in those costumes, they’re got to stay 6 feet away from people! Disney has also canceled all parades and nighttime spectaculars, so you may have to wait for your next trip to see the firework shows. And the makeovers at Disney Spas and Boutiques are all still unavailable – most Disney experiences besides the rides are being postponed to avoid close contact.

A YouTuber is getting backlash for vlogging and going to the parks even though she was complaining about a sore throat and feeling sick. She said it wasn’t COVID, but refused to get tested. This shows that even if Disney has great precautions for guests, people will leave their house and go to public areas even if they are sick. On a similar note, the Disneyland park in Hong Kong reopened in June but is now closing again. This closure came from the increase of cases after they reopened.
